What is it about?

We investigated the effects of dust on solar PV modules for tracking and stationary modules. The aim was to see if we could reduce the impact of dust soiling with some passive dust mitigation strategies.

Featured Image

Why is it important?

It was the first formal study in South Africa regarding the effects of dust on solar power output and how these effects could be reduced (if at all) with some passive (little to no human effort) strategies. We have proven that the use of anti-soiling coatings is perhaps not the best idea considering the added costs.
